Understanding Tesla Insurance Coverage

Tesla insurance typically includes liability coverage, which protects the policyholder from legal claims if they cause an accident. This coverage is essential for all drivers, regardless of whether they are using their own vehicle or a rental car. However, when it comes to rental cars, the question of comprehensive and collision coverage becomes more relevant.

Comprehensive and Collision Coverage

Comprehensive coverage protects against damages to the rental car that are not caused by a collision, such as theft, vandalism, or natural disasters. Collision coverage, on the other hand, covers damages to the rental car resulting from a collision with another vehicle or object.

Does Tesla Insurance Cover Rental Cars for Vacation?

The answer to this question is not straightforward. Tesla insurance does not automatically cover rental cars for vacation. While liability coverage is typically included, comprehensive and collision coverage may require additional purchase from the rental car company.

How to Ensure Coverage

To ensure that you are adequately covered when renting a car for your vacation, follow these steps:

1. Check your Tesla insurance policy: Review your policy to understand the extent of your coverage and any exclusions related to rental cars.
2. Inform the rental car company: When renting a car, inform the company that you have Tesla insurance. They may ask for your policy number and coverage details.
3. Purchase additional coverage: If your Tesla insurance does not cover comprehensive and collision for rental cars, consider purchasing additional coverage from the rental car company. This will protect you from any unexpected expenses that may arise during your vacation.
